Real Madrid 'bow out of Luis Suarez race'

A report in Spain claims that Real Madrid have no interest in signing Liverpool's Luis Suarez.

Real Madrid have no interest in signing striker Luis Suarez from Liverpool, according to a report.

Coach Carlo Ancelotti is not looking to bring in another forward as he is satisfied with his strike force of Cristiano Ronaldo and Karim Benzema, Marca claims.

Real are on the verge of selling Gonzalo Higuain to Napoli, but Ancelotti is reportedly hoping to give more opportunities to youngsters Jese Rodriguez and Alvaro Morata next season rather than bring in another big-name striker.

"We believe in Jese and Morata and they deserve this chance. They are also very good. We are not going to sign a new forward," a club insider allegedly told the Spanish newspaper.

The move has given rise to reports that Arsenal are in pole position to sign Suarez, although the Gunners recently had a bid of £42m turned down.

Liverpool are reportedly unwilling to sell Suarez for less than £50m.
